Why is NVIDIA stock sliding today?
⦿ Executive Snapshot
- What: NVIDIA's stock fell 3.68% amid profit-taking after a significant rally.
- Who: Key players include NVIDIA (NVDA), Bank of America analyst Vivek Arya, and derivatives analyst Brent Kochuba.
- Why it matters: The stock's performance reflects broader market dynamics and investor sentiment ahead of an important earnings report, impacting market perceptions of tech stocks.
⦿ Key Developments
- NVIDIA shares dropped 3.68% after a 20% increase since May 5, indicating profit-taking behavior.
- The upcoming earnings report on May 20 is pivotal, with high expectations given the recent stock surge and market catalysts.
- $40 billion in options delta trading contrasted with just $4 billion in total premium, indicating significant leverage and selling pressure on expiry day.
⦿ Strategic Context
- NVIDIA's stock had previously surged due to news of Chinese companies being authorized to purchase its AI processors, showcasing the stock's volatility tied to geopolitical events.
- The current downturn is occurring within a broader risk-off environment across equity markets, reflecting investor caution amidst macroeconomic uncertainties.
